SquareMeal Review of Faber

Bronze Award

West London’s hot new seafood restaurant finds its home on a busy stretch of main road overlooking Hammersmith’s concrete bus station. It feels like a confusing choice for this plush spot, but the dining room’s luxe aesthetic and friendly staff do a fine job of shutting out the city noise.  

Once inside, we’re ensconced by a calming oasis of cream tones and pale stone. There’s a swish terracotta-tiled bar in the corner amongst other expensive touches, like impressive block columns, a large arched mirror and vintage-style chandeliers. You have to hand it to whoever designed the place; we feel closer to the Cote D’Azur than Hammersmith roundabout.  

Manning the kitchen is executive chef Ollie Bass (ex-Quo Vadis and Sessions Arts Club) who’s ever-changing menus revolve around smaller, fish-focused sharing plates and a daily specials board. Every dish that arrives is impossibly pretty, and there’s some fine skill going on here too, from a gorgeous, smoky cod cheek skewer served with warm, homemade tartare, to a crisp block of potato terrine topped with soft haddock, smoky beetroot puree and the tang of creme fraiche. A moment for the chips, which are supremely chunky batons of fluffy potato heaven and an excellent way to spend £6, if you ask us. 

The wine list offers a lovely selection ‘from British shores’ alongside coastal and inland options. We sampled a delicious Sussex-grown Bacchus filled with minerality and elderflower, and paired unsurprisingly well with seafood and fish. 

Faber seems to be onto a trick here – it was fairly busy for a Tuesday night, and we imagine its 20 quid lunch deal does a fine job at attracting workers midweek. If you're seeking a getaway to sunnier climes, Faber isn’t a bad way to tide you over in the meantime.

About

Faber is a seafood restaurant in Hammersmith which champions the best of British day-boat fish. This new opening flung its doors wide at the end of 2023 and is a joint vision from friends Matt and Anthony, who together have 17 years of experience in the hospitality industry. They started with shellfish and cocktail deliveries via bikes in lockdown and now have a gorgeous space on Hammersmith Road. 

A period building with handsome arched walls, exposed brick and huge windows, the space is flooded with light and complemented by stylish, contemporary decor is soft hues. Relaxing and atmospheric, the dining room works for dinners with friends, impressing clients with the hottest new thing in town, and even a date. 

Before taking a look at the menu, it's important to understand the context behind the produce the team have hand-picked and pain-stakingly sourced. Indeed, everything you see and taste is courtesy of important relationships with local fishmongers who reach the coast each evening to collect day-boat fish and local ingredients, fulfilling a goal that the menu be sustainably sourced and support the local economy.

Because of this, you can't always plan your order ahead but there is a sample menu online to get a flavour of what's to come. Generally, you can expect rock oysters from Maldon and Essex, Dorset crab on toast, and burrata with sea vegetable salad and dulse breadcrumbs.

We like the sound of the BBQ Orkney scallop with cauliflower and pastis puree, pickled cucumber and chervil, alongside Cornwall grilled cod cheek skewer with tartar sauce, and Sussex slow roasted pork belly with pink fir potatoes. If you're dying to know what you're about to tuck into, check the daily menu on Instagram. As for drinks, we like that the cocktail menu has a nautical twist with tipples like a Sugar Kelp Old Fashioned with syrup made with kelp from Car Y Mor, Wrecking Coast rye whisky, sugar kelp and bitters.

Ollie Bass

Executive Chef

The executive chef at Faber in Hammersmith, Ollie Bass has an innate passion for responsible sourcing and high quality ingredients. He's worked at some of London's most revered restaurants, from Quo Vadis to Sessions Arts Club, but his particular love for seafood stems from his experiences as a child, growing up on the Cornish coast, cooking on the beach and visiting Rick Stein's in Padstow.
